Handover: FeedLint validator (from Dario to Priva's team). FeedLint checks podcast RSS feeds for the Castwell platform before they hit the ingest queue. It runs as a single worker on the staging box, polling every five minutes. Nothing exotic: failures land in the quarantine table and get retried twice. For new folks, the main thing to know is the runtime settings. The current values are as follows.

settings of tagef-bawif:
DRUIX_HOST=druix.zemvarlabs.internal
DRUIX_PORT=8000

// Broker upgrade notes for plugin authors:
// Quillbus 4.x replaces the legacy 3.x wire protocol. Plugins must
// construct the client with explicit protocol negotiation enabled,
// or connections to the Larkfield cluster will be silently downgraded
// and dropped after 30s. Topic names are unchanged. For local testing
// against the sandbox broker, authenticate with the key below.

API key for bafof-bagaf: qvz2-qi

## Tuning reconnects

The Larkspur gateway had a long-standing bug where websocket clients reconnected in lockstep after a broker restart, producing a thundering herd that could stall the whole Fenwick cluster. We now apply decorrelated jitter with a hard cap, and the backoff state survives process restarts via the session cache. Do not lower the cap without re-running the herd simulation in the staging lab. The constants below control backoff, jitter spread, and heartbeat grace periods.

tuning constants:
QUOTAS = {
    "druwyn": 5,
    "holix": 5,
    "zorath": 5,
    "holwyn": 10,
}

Facilities Ticket — Roof-Terrace Door Keeps Jamming (Bellvane Tower)

Heads up: the roof-terrace door on Level 9 is sticking again, usually after rain. Maintenance has a part on order, so in the meantime give it a firm push rather than forcing the handle — we've already replaced one hinge this month. If it fully jams, use the stairwell exit on the east side instead. That door needs the code below to open.

staff pass of kahof-yaduf = bdg-N-12